Training this morning in perfect conditions but with a number of players rested until the main session on Friday. These included Goddard, Baguley, Zerrett, Gwilt, Tippa, Zaka, Stokes, Kelly, Cooney, McKenna and Dea. It appears at present that those unavailable this week will be Francis, Laverde and Morgan.
The session concentrated on tackling, shepherding/blocking with full ground practice of ball movement drills from defence to full forward. It is evident that there is a fair bit of competition going on between groups of players for particular spots in the team for the upcoming ANZAC Day clash. For instance, Crowley v Bird v Simpkin, Kommer v Dempsey v McKenna.
While it was a lighter session with some of the bigger names missing it was positive in the quality of the training level produced by those on the track.
